DroneShield (ASX:DRO) develops market-leading counter-drone solutions used by military organisations, government agencies, airports, critical infrastructure operators, and law enforcement operating in some of the most challenging and high-stakes environments in the world. Employees work at the forefront of innovation, solving complex technical problems and delivering mission-critical capabilities where performance, reliability, and speed matter.

As an ASX200-listed company and the world's only publicly listed pure-play counter-drone business, DroneShield is experiencing rapid growth. Revenue increased from A$57 million in 2024 to more than A$217 million in 2025, supported by record profitability, a global sales pipeline exceeding A$2.5 billion, and annual R&D investment of over A$50 million.

Since 2017, DroneShield has grown from 11 employees to more than 550 globally, with operations across Australia, the United States, Europe, and the Middle East, supporting customers in over 70 countries.
